Responsible for assisting the Records Manager in the day to day business operations of the McGraw-Hill Companies’ Global Records Management and Compliance program.
§ Review and process all records management requests submitted to the Facilities Call Center. Review archive transmittal forms for accuracy and confirm compliance with MGH records management program policies, procedures and retention schedules. (50%)
· Conduct computer searches upon request to locate archived information from offsite storage providers.
· Ensure that all requests are completed in a timely and accurate manner.
· Research and resolve discrepancies encountered during the above processes and communicate difficult issues or problems to manager.
· coordinate all record traffic to and from the offsite records storage vendor
§ Assist in maintaining the corporation’s records retention schedule database by creating new schedules, revising existent schedules and tracking schedule approvals. (25%)
§ Coordinate requests for secure shredding bins with the vendor and coordinate delivery of bins for adhoc department clean-outs. (25%)
§ Assist in identifying and updating record information for files stored prior to the launch of the records management program
§ Complete special projects as assigned by a Records Manager.
§ Processes monthly Iron Mountain and Secure Shredding provider invoices.
§ Participate in making arrangements for records reviews, periodic records management training and department records coordinator meetings
§ Assist in the coordination of the annual company clean-out
